Indicates the current that flows into a 3-state output pin when it is in a high-
impedance state and a voltage is applied to the pin.
Indicates the current that flows from an output pin when it is shorted to GND
while it is at high-level.
Indicates the current that flows into an input pin when a voltage is applied to
the pin.
